The seventh overall pick of the 2020 Draft, Defensive Tackle Derrick Brown has yet to taste the playoffs, but that is no fault of Brown, who has been a solid contributor to the Panthers’ defense.
Brown won the starting job as a rookie and was a solid run-stuffer able to clog the interior. After three solid years, Brown had a breakout campaign in 2023, where he went to his first Pro Bowl and had his first 100-plus tackle year.
While Carolina has struggled, Brown has proven that he is a proven piece that the organization can build around defensively.
